Transaction eb49c6f41dd9f0a94a8f598da79c058fc31ce6231abcf3e417a728455dbeec0a

50 Input
1 Outputs
  • eb49c6f41dd9f0a94a8f598da79c058fc31ce6231abcf3e417a728455dbeec0a:0
  • value  3681883
    address  3HXcKwBE75trPEydx1hZ8h95DvYyDjW2HJ